Sha256: 07eadd82784d5a92e0aa71f3dad8f6466e5aaecf85f7afe7be6543e9ae238ac6

Contents?: true

Size: 523 Bytes

Versions: 2

Compression:

Stored size: 523 Bytes

Contents

class DeviseTwilioVerifyAddTo<%= table_name.camelize %> < ActiveRecord::Migration<%= migration_version %>
  def self.up
    change_table :<%= table_name %> do |t|
      t.string    :authy_id
      t.datetime  :last_sign_in_with_twilio_verify
      t.boolean   :twilio_verify_enabled, :default => false
    end

    add_index :<%= table_name %>, :authy_id
  end

  def self.down
    change_table :<%= table_name %> do |t|
      t.remove :authy_id, :last_sign_in_with_twilio_verify, :twilio_verify_enabled
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
devise-twilio-verify-0.1.1 lib/generators/active_record/templates/migration.rb
devise-twilio-verify-0.1.0 lib/generators/active_record/templates/migration.rb